Каким образом обеспечивается правильность исполнения программных систем

Каким образом обеспечивается правильность исполнения программных систем

Стабильность работы программных решений является фундаментальным требованием относительно любому информационному продукту. Безотносительно от масштаба проекта — начиная с небольшого прикладного инструмента вплоть до комплексной распределенной платформы — система обязана реализовывать заявленные операции надежно, контролируемо а также без отклонений выхода. Гарантирование устойчивости не заканчивается написанием рабочего алгоритма. Это 7к казино официальный сайт комплексный подход, включающий архитектурную разработку, валидацию, контроль данных, отслеживание а также непрерывную сопровождение, что глубоко освещается в аналитических материалах 7к казино.

Система работает в заданной среде выполнения: базовая платформа, аппаратные ресурсы, сетевое контекст, внешние системы. Любое изменение этих параметров способно изменить на логику программы. Поэтому устойчивость рассматривается не только в качестве минимизация сбоев в реализации, но и как возможность программы обеспечивать корректность при разнообразных режимах работы.

Формализация условий и техническое описание

Обеспечение стабильности запускается намного раньше до реализации кода. На самом стартовом этапе создается проектное описание, в рамках которого описываются операции системы, модели применения, рамки а также ожидаемые итоги. Четко прописанные требования позволяют минимизировать неоднозначностей и логических ошибок в коде.

Важно определить граничные сценарии, исключительные режимы и разрешенные расхождения. В случае если условия сохраняются нечеткими, корректность превращается условной характеристикой. Точное описание показателей позволяет сделать осуществимой проверяемую валидацию соответствия программы требованиям 7k казино.

Дополнительно формируются пользовательские модели и диаграммы операций, отражающие порядок шагов в пределах программы. Такие схемы позволяют выявлять логические несоответствия ещё до этапа реализации а также оптимизировать архитектуру разрабатываемого приложения.

Проектирование структуры и каркаса программы

Профессионально организованная архитектура существенно минимизирует вероятность ошибок. Разделение приложения на самостоятельные модули, соблюдение подходов изоляции и снижение переплетений между модулями укрепляют надежность системы. Самостоятельные компоненты удобнее проверять и модифицировать без искажения глобальной архитектуры.

Ясная структура программы ускоряет обслуживание а также проверку. Использование логичных обозначений переменных казино 7 к, и дополнительно соблюдение общих конвенций разработки уменьшает шанс неочевидных логических ошибок.

Важным преимуществом является потенциал развития системы. Если части программы изолированы, эти элементы возможно развивать параллельно, сохраняя общую стабильность решения.

Предварительный разбор и аудит кода

Перед запуска программы в использование выполняется проверка кода. Статический разбор находит потенциальные дефекты, несоответствия структуры а также некорректные фрагменты. Программные системы 7к казино официальный сайт позволяют фиксировать распространенные дефекты на предварительном уровне.

Аудит реализации со участием других экспертов позволяет распознать логические ошибки, которые зачастую могут оставаться скрытыми для создателя кода. Командная экспертиза повышает качество реализации и поддерживает стандартизацию структурных решений.

В проверки дополнительно рассматривается читаемость и масштабируемость программы, что важно для длительной поддержки и снижения увеличения программных ошибок.

Многоуровневое проверка

Тестирование выступает основным способом подтверждения корректности. Модульные тесты 7k казино проверяют изолированные функции, связующие — взаимодействие между частями, комплексные — поведение приложения в полном объеме. Такой комплексный подход поддерживает полную проверку надежности.

Особое роль занимают тесты на граничные параметры и нестандартные сценарии. Дефекты как правило обнаруживаются при обработке с пограничными данными, в отсутствии данных или при непредсказуемых структурах исходной параметров.

Дополнительно используются регрессионные тесты, которые проверить, что последние правки не исказили ранее части приложения. Это казино 7 к гарантирует надежность в процессе обновления решения.

Контроль входных данных

Программа обязана корректно интерпретировать поступающие значения независимо к их источника. Валидация формата, пределов значений и необходимых атрибутов снижает выполнение неверных действий. Проверка оберегает приложение от логических сбоев а также нестабильного поведения.

Помимо к тому же, критично обеспечить фильтрацию от умышленно некорректных вводов. Отсеивание а также валидация структуры поступающих значений исключают искажение целостности системы.

Периодическая проверка достоверности наборов 7к казино официальный сайт помогает обеспечивать стабильность механизмов анализа и увеличивает качество результатов исполнения программы.

Обработка ошибок

Даже глубоком тестировании полностью устранить проявление дефектов невозможно. Поэтому приложение необходимо чтобы реализовывать инструменты перехвата аварийных ситуаций. Когда возникновении исключения программа должна или аккуратно завершить выполнение, или перейти в безопасное формат.

Фиксация ошибок помогает анализировать источники сбоев а также устранять их в следующих версиях. Недостаток эффективной механики обработки ошибок может спровоцировать к цепным сбоям в функционировании системы.

Структурированные сообщения 7k казино о сбоях даёт возможность эффективнее диагностировать проблемы а также облегчают обслуживание приложения.

Мониторинг стабильности

Стабильность включает не только правильность вычислений, но и устойчивость функционирования во реальных условиях. Программа обязана корректно функционировать в изменяющихся нагрузках, не допуская перерасхода ресурсов, остановок либо падения производительности.

Интенсивное испытание даёт возможность распознать слабые точки и оценить реакцию программы в максимальной интенсивности операций. Настройка алгоритмов поддерживает устойчивость функционирования в продолжительной перспективе.

Постоянный контроль производительности позволяет своевременно обнаруживать тенденции снижения работы а также минимизировать отказы.

Отслеживание после эксплуатации

Даже при выпуска приложения важен непрерывный контроль. Отслеживание помогает контролировать основные параметры: количество ошибок, время отклика, использование памяти. Разбор таких метрик помогает заранее обнаруживать аномалии.

Своевременное реагирование на нестандартные показатели исключает эскалацию масштабных проблем и поддерживает корректность функционирования в эксплуатационных сценариях казино 7 к.

Дополнительно используются инструменты алертов, что уведомлять специалистов о серьёзных отклонениях в реальном реального момента.

Контроль версий

Обновление приложения неизбежно сопровождается с внесением обновлений. Использование механизмов контроля версий позволяет записывать каждую корректировку а также анализировать её влияние на функциональность. Подобный подход упрощает откат к рабочему релизу при появлении сбоев.

Контролируемое развертывание версий и обязательное проверка каждой итерации позволяют сохранить корректность системы и предотвратить масштабных сбоев.

Журнал изменений служит средством анализа эволюции системы а также позволяет распознавать типовые сбои.

Безопасность в качестве составляющая корректности

Нарушение безопасности способно вызвать к повреждению результатов и нестабильной реализации системы. В связи с этим защита от несанкционированного доступа, ограничение прав пользователей и системное актуализация библиотек являются элементом поддержания надежности 7к казино официальный сайт.

Защита данных и контроль сетевых снижают внешние нарушения, которые могут нарушить работу программы.

Регулярные проверки уязвимостей помогают фиксировать слабые места до того момента, если они вызовут к серьёзным последствиям.

Поддержка

Подробная документация упрощает сопровождение системы и снижает вероятность сбоев в модификации. Описание архитектуры функционирования позволяет подключающимся разработчикам оперативно ориентироваться в структуре проекта.

Регулярное корректировка документации гарантирует соответствие реальному версии системы и обеспечивает корректность в процессе её обновления.

Хорошо подготовленные руководства кроме того ускоряют реализацию новых модулей 7k казино а также ускоряют обучение пользователей.

Вывод

Корректность работы программ достигается системным механизмом, включающим четкую постановку условий, грамотную архитектуру, тестирование, мониторинг и отслеживание изменениями. Подобная система казино 7 к служит непрерывным циклом, сопровождающим весь эксплуатационный этап решения.

Именно связка программной аккуратности, системного анализа а также непрерывного мониторинга даёт возможность гарантировать предсказуемость цифровых систем в контексте динамичной инфраструктуры.